Alcatel And Unicom Enable First Commercial Web Browsing Service Through WAP Handsets

June 4, 2004
Telecom & Wireless

Alcatel and China Unicom, one of China's mobile service providers today announced the availability of the first commercial WAP 2.0 service in China.

This service enables WAP users to browse web pages through their mobile handsets. The introduction of WAP 2.0 service results from a contract previously concluded between Alcatel Shanghai Bell, Alcatel's flagship Chinese Company and China Unicom. Operational since April 2004, the Alcatel WAP 2.0 solution is connected to China Unicom's nation-wide mobile data network and automatically switches users between current WAP applications and new WAP 2.0 services such as mobile web browsing, HTTP-powered games, and other mobile Internet applications. Based on Alcatel's WAP 2.0 platform, more than 500,000 WAP subscribers will enjoy the new value-added services.

The Alcatel WAP 2.0 solution delivers carrier-grade mobile Internet applications that run on the Intel Xeon processor using a Linux operating environment. The WAP 2.0 platform's high level of efficiency and flexibility is achieved by incorporating the Alcatel 5311 WAP gateway software. A customized diagnostic and analysis package included with the WAP 2.0 platform enables fully remote maintenance and rapid resolution of potential system faults and will help the operator reduce operating expenses while ensuring high quality of service levels.
